《MICROSFT QUICKBASIC编译程序实用指南》PDF提取 ⇩

第一部分用户指南1

第一章导言1

1.1 欢迎1

1.2 系统要求1

1.3 本书概况1

1.4 符号规定2

1.5 键名4

1.6 学习资料4

第二章准备开始6

2.1 复制备用磁盘6

2.2 磁盘内容6

2.3 建立编译程序7

2.4 启动QuickBASIC8

2.5 观察帮助窗口8

第三章探讨QuickBASIC9

3.1 假如你有一个mouse9

3.2 QuickBASIC屏幕10

3.3 从菜单中选取命令11

3.4 简捷命令键12

3.5 从对话框内选取附加信息13

3.6 进行选择14

3.7 滚动屏幕14

3.8 练习15

3.9 使用调试模式35

3.10 生成一个用户程序库38

第四章编译和运行一个程序41

4.1 启动QuickBASIC41

4.2 文件菜单(The File Menu)43

4.3 视图菜单(The View Menu)47

4.4 运行菜单(The Run Menu)50

第五章编辑和调试57

5.1 QuickBASIC编辑器57

5.2 编辑菜单59

5.3 搜索菜单61

5.4 调试方式64

第六章使用各种子程序67

6.1 说明各种子程序67

6.2 调用各种子程序68

6.3 用CALL命令来传递变量68

6.4 用CALL命令来传递数组69

6.5 用SHARD命令来存取各种参数71

6.6 用户程序库里的各种子程序74

6.7 常见的错误74

第七章生成用户库77

7.1 建立一个用户库77

7.2 指定一个用户库77

7.3 QuickBASIC用户库程序78

第八章用汇编语言接口79

8.1 用CALL和CALLs调用汇编子程序79

8.2 为编译器编写子程序81

8.3 将数组传递给汇编语言子程序84

8.4 调用系统服务:中断支持程序84

8.5 运行时内存映象88

第二部分参考资料89

第九章程序语句89

9.1 字符集89

9.2 QuickBASIC程序行90

9.3 数据类型91

9.4 常数92

9.5 变量94

9.6 表达式和运算符96

9.7 类型转换103

第十章编译与解释程序的语言的差别105

10.1 程序设计的新特点105

10.2 新的BASIC语句和函数107

10.3 元命令的使用107

10.4 编译程序与解释程序的差异108

第十一章语句和函数参考资料113

1 ABC函数113

2 ASC函数113

3 ATN函数114

4 BEEP语句114

5 BLOAD语句115

6 BSAVE语句116

7 CALL,CAL ABSOLUTE语句116

8 CALLS语句118

9 CDBL函数118

10 CHAIN语句120

11 CHDIR语句122

12 CHR$函数122

13 CINT函数123

14 CIRCLE语句125

15 CLEAR语句127

16 CLOSE语句128

17 CLS语句128

18 COLOR语句129

19 COM语句130

20 COMMAND$函数131

21 COMMON语句133

22 COS函数136

23 CSNG函数137

24 CSRLIN函数137

25 CVI,CVS,CVD函数138

26 DATA语句140

27 DATE$函数141

28 DATE$语句141

29 DEF FN语句142

30 DEF SEG函数145

31 DEF type语句146

32 DIM语句148

33 DRAW语句149

34 END语句152

35 ENVIRON$函数153

36 ENVIRON语句154

37 EOF函数154

38 ERASE语句155

39 ERDEV,ERDEV$函数156

40 ERR,ERL函数156

41 ERROR语句157

42 EXIT语句159

43 EXP函数159

44 FIELD语句160

45 FILES语句162

46 FIX函数162

47 FOR…NEXT语句163

48 FRE函数166

49 GET语句(文件输入/输出)167

50 GET语句的图形功能168

51 GOSUB…RETURN语句169

52 GOTO语句171

53 HEX$函数172

54 IF…THEN…ELSE语句173

55 INKEY $函数175

56 INP函数176

57 INPUT语句176

58 INPUT#语句178

59 INPUT$函数179

60 INSTR函数180

61 INT函数181

62 IOCTL$函数182

63 IOCTL语句182

64 KEY语句183

65 KEY(n)语句184

66 KILL语句186

67 LBOUND函数188

68 LEFT$函数189

69 LEN函数189

70 LET语句190

71 LINE语句191

72 LINE INPUT语句192

73 LINE INPUT#语句193

74 LOC函数195

75 LOCATE语句195

76 LOCK…UNLOCK语句197

77 LOC函数199

78 LOG函数201

79 LPOS函数201

80 LPRINT,LPRINT USING语句202

81 LSET语句203

82 MID$函数203

83 MID$语句204

84 MKDIR语句205

85 MKD$,MKI$,MKS$函数206

86 NAME语句206

87 OCT$函数207

88 ON COM语句207

89 ON ERROR GOTO语句208

90 ON…GOSUB,ON…GOTO语句209

91 ON KEY语句210

92 ON PEN语句212

93 ON PLAY语句213

94 ON STRIG语句214

95 ON TIMER语句215

96 OPEN语句217

97 OPEN COM语句220

98 OPTION BASE语句221

99 OUT语句222

100 PAINT语句222

101 PALETTE,PALETTE USING语句225

102 PCOPY语句228

103 PEEK函数228

104 PEN函数228

105 PEN ON,PEN OFF,PEN STOP语句229

106 PLAY函数229

107 PLAY语句230

108 PLAY ON,PLAY OFF,PLAY STOP语句232

109 PMAP函数232

110 POINT函数233

111 POKE语句234

112 POS函数235

113 PRESET语句235

114 PRINT语句236

115 PRINT#,PRINT# USING语句238

116 PRINT USING语句239

117 PSET语句242

118 PUT语句-I/O文件243

119 PUT语句-图形243

120 RANDOMIZE语句246

121 READ语句247

122 REDIM语句248

123 REM语句250

124 RESET语句251

125 RESTORE语句251

126 RESUME语句252

127 RETURN语句254

128 RIGHT$函数254

129 RMDIR语句255

130 RND函数256

131 RSET语句257

132 RUN语句257

133 SADD函数259

134 SCREEN函数260

135 SCREEN语句260

136 SGN函数266

137 SHARED语句266

138 SHELL语句268

139 SIN函数270

140 SOUND语句271

141 SPACE$函数271

142 SPC函数271

143 SQR函数273

144 STATIC语句273

145 STICK函数276

146 STOP语句277

147 STR$语句278

148 STRIG函数279

149 STRIG ON,STRIG OFF,STRIG STOP语句280

150 STRING$函数280

151 SUB…END SUB语句282

152 SWAP语句284

153 SYSTEM语句285

154 TAB函数285

155 TAN函数286

156 TIME$函数287

157 TIME$语句287

158 TIMER函数288

159 TIMER ON,TINER OFF,TIMER STOP语句289

160 TRON/TROFF语句290

161 UBOUND函数291

162 UNLOCK语句292

163 VAL函数292

164 VARPTR函数293

165 VARPTR$函数295

166 VIEW语句296

167 VIEW PRINT语句296

168 WAIT语句297

169 WHILE…WEND语句297

170 WIDTH语句298

171 WINDOW语句303

172 WRITE语句303

173 WRITE#语句303

第三部分附录305

附录A ASCⅡ字符编码305

附录B QuickBASIC保留字307

附录CQuickBASIC 1.0版本和2.0版本之间的差异309

C、1 1.0版本与2.0版本之间的兼容性309

C、2 命令行309

C、3 各种选择309

C、4 IBM增强型图形支持适配器309

C、5 新的语言特点310

C、6 使用microsoft word文件310

附录D使用分离编译法311

D、1 磁盘准备311

D、2 编译313

D、3 链接314

D、4 运行一个程序316

D、5 运行时内存映象图319

附录E、错误信息320

E、1调用错误320

E、2 编译时的错误320

E、3 运行时错误329

1988《MICROSFT QUICKBASIC编译程序实用指南》由于是年代较久的资料都绝版了,几乎不可能购买到实物。如果大家为了学习确实需要,博主可为大家寻取其电子版PDF文件(由张伟钧,韩瑞雪译 1988 北京:中国轻工业出版社 出版的版本) ,有需要的可以向博主求助,我会及时受理并将完整335页PDF电子档下载地址发送给你。